
在Excel中,自动乘以0.8可以通过使用公式、创建自定义函数、或利用VBA宏来实现。其中,使用公式是最简单且最常用的方法。在Excel中使用公式来自动乘以0.8,只需要在目标单元格中输入适当的乘法公式即可。创建自定义函数或利用VBA宏,则适用于需要批量处理或有更复杂需求的情况。下面将详细介绍这几种方法。
一、使用公式实现自动乘以0.8
在Excel中,最直接的方法是使用公式来实现自动乘以0.8。假设您有一列数据需要乘以0.8,可以按照以下步骤进行操作:
- 选中目标单元格。
- 输入公式
=原始单元格*0.8,例如=A1*0.8。 - 按回车键确认公式。
这样,Excel会自动计算并显示乘以0.8后的结果。要将公式应用于整个列,可以将鼠标指针放在公式单元格右下角的小方块上,待指针变成十字形时,拖动至需要应用公式的范围。
二、创建自定义函数
如果需要经常进行某种特定的计算,可以通过创建自定义函数来简化操作。自定义函数可以通过VBA(Visual Basic for Applications)来实现。
创建自定义函数的步骤:
- 打开Excel,按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,点击
插入菜单,然后选择模块。 - 在新模块中输入以下代码:
Function MultiplyByEight(InputValue As Double) As DoubleMultiplyByEight = InputValue * 0.8
End Function
- 保存并关闭VBA编辑器。
现在,您可以在Excel中使用 MultiplyByEight 函数。例如,在单元格中输入 =MultiplyByEight(A1),它将返回A1单元格的值乘以0.8后的结果。
三、使用VBA宏批量处理
对于需要批量处理的数据,可以使用VBA宏来实现自动乘以0.8。VBA宏可以帮助您快速处理大量数据,尤其适用于重复性任务。
创建VBA宏的步骤:
- 打开Excel,按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,点击
插入菜单,然后选择模块。 - 在新模块中输入以下代码:
Sub MultiplyRangeByEight()Dim rng As Range
Dim cell As Range
' Prompt user to select the range
Set rng = Application.InputBox("Select the range to multiply by 0.8", Type:=8)
For Each cell In rng
If IsNumeric(cell.Value) Then
cell.Value = cell.Value * 0.8
End If
Next cell
End Sub
- 保存并关闭VBA编辑器。
要运行宏,按下 Alt + F8 打开宏对话框,选择 MultiplyRangeByEight,然后点击 运行。系统会提示您选择一个范围,选择后,宏会自动将范围内的所有数值乘以0.8。
四、使用Excel函数与数据分析工具
在Excel中,可以利用函数和数据分析工具来实现更高级的数据处理和分析。以下是一些常用的函数和工具。
1、使用IF函数和条件格式
IF函数可以帮助您根据条件执行不同的计算。结合条件格式,您可以对满足特定条件的单元格进行格式化。
示例:
=IF(A1>100, A1*0.8, A1)
上述公式表示,如果A1单元格的值大于100,则将其乘以0.8,否则保持不变。
2、使用数据透视表
数据透视表是Excel中强大的数据分析工具。通过数据透视表,您可以快速汇总、分析和展示数据。
创建数据透视表的步骤:
- 选中数据范围。
- 点击
插入菜单,选择数据透视表。 - 在弹出的对话框中,选择数据源和目标位置,点击
确定。 - 在数据透视表字段列表中,拖动字段至行、列和数值区域,进行数据分析。
五、Excel中的自动化工具
为了进一步提高工作效率,可以使用Excel中的一些自动化工具,如宏录制器和Power Query。
1、使用宏录制器
宏录制器可以帮助您记录一系列操作,并将其转化为VBA代码。您可以通过录制宏来自动化重复性任务。
录制宏的步骤:
- 点击
视图菜单,选择宏,然后点击录制宏。 - 在弹出的对话框中,输入宏名称并选择存储位置,点击
确定。 - 执行您希望录制的操作。
- 完成操作后,点击
视图菜单,选择宏,然后点击停止录制。
2、使用Power Query
Power Query是Excel中的强大数据连接和转换工具。通过Power Query,您可以从各种数据源导入数据,并进行清洗和转换。
使用Power Query的步骤:
- 点击
数据菜单,选择获取数据。 - 选择数据源并导入数据。
- 在Power Query编辑器中,进行数据清洗和转换操作。
- 完成后,点击
关闭并加载,将数据加载到Excel中。
六、Excel中的高级技巧
熟练掌握Excel中的一些高级技巧,可以大大提高您的工作效率。以下是一些常用的高级技巧。
1、使用数组公式
数组公式可以处理多个单元格中的数据,并返回多个结果。它们通常用于复杂的数据计算和分析。
示例:
{=A1:A10*B1:B10}
上述公式表示将A1到A10单元格的值与B1到B10单元格的值逐个相乘,并返回结果。
2、使用动态数组公式
Excel 365引入了动态数组公式,它们可以自动扩展和收缩,以适应返回的结果范围。常用的动态数组公式包括SORT、UNIQUE、FILTER等。
示例:
=SORT(A1:A10)
上述公式表示对A1到A10单元格的值进行排序,并返回排序结果。
七、Excel中的数据可视化
数据可视化是将数据转化为图表和图形,以便于理解和分析。Excel提供了多种图表类型和数据可视化工具。
1、创建图表
Excel中的图表种类繁多,包括柱状图、折线图、饼图、散点图等。创建图表的步骤如下:
- 选中数据范围。
- 点击
插入菜单,选择图表类型。 - 在图表工具中,进行图表格式化和设置。
2、使用条件格式
条件格式可以根据特定条件对单元格进行格式化,以突出显示重要数据。使用条件格式的步骤如下:
- 选中数据范围。
- 点击
开始菜单,选择条件格式。 - 选择格式规则和格式样式,点击
确定。
八、Excel中的数据保护与共享
为了确保数据的安全性和完整性,Excel提供了多种数据保护和共享功能。
1、保护工作表和工作簿
保护工作表和工作簿可以防止未经授权的修改。保护工作表的步骤如下:
- 点击
审阅菜单,选择保护工作表。 - 设置密码和保护选项,点击
确定。
保护工作簿的步骤如下:
- 点击
文件菜单,选择保护工作簿。 - 选择保护选项,设置密码,点击
确定。
2、共享工作簿
共享工作簿可以让多位用户同时编辑同一个Excel文件。共享工作簿的步骤如下:
- 点击
审阅菜单,选择共享工作簿。 - 勾选
允许多用户同时编辑选项,点击确定。
九、Excel中的数据导入与导出
Excel支持从多种数据源导入数据,并将数据导出为多种格式。以下是一些常用的数据导入与导出方法。
1、从外部数据源导入数据
Excel可以从数据库、Web、文本文件等外部数据源导入数据。导入数据的步骤如下:
- 点击
数据菜单,选择获取数据。 - 选择数据源并导入数据。
- 在导入向导中,设置数据格式和选项,点击
完成。
2、将数据导出为其他格式
Excel可以将数据导出为CSV、PDF等多种格式。导出数据的步骤如下:
- 点击
文件菜单,选择另存为。 - 选择保存位置和文件格式,点击
保存。
十、Excel中的常用快捷键
熟练掌握Excel中的快捷键,可以大大提高您的工作效率。以下是一些常用的Excel快捷键。
1、基本快捷键
- Ctrl + C:复制
- Ctrl + X:剪切
- Ctrl + V:粘贴
- Ctrl + Z:撤销
- Ctrl + Y:重做
2、导航快捷键
- Ctrl + 箭头键:快速移动到数据区域的边缘
- Ctrl + Home:移动到工作表的开头
- Ctrl + End:移动到工作表的最后一个单元格
3、公式快捷键
- Ctrl + `:显示/隐藏公式
- F2:编辑单元格
- Ctrl + Shift + Enter:输入数组公式
通过以上方法,您可以在Excel中轻松实现自动乘以0.8的操作,并掌握更多的数据处理和分析技巧。希望这篇文章对您有所帮助!
相关问答FAQs:
1. 为什么我的Excel公式自动乘以0.8没有生效?
可能是因为您没有正确输入公式或者使用了错误的语法。请确保在公式中正确地引用了要乘以0.8的单元格,并且在乘法操作符(*)前后都有正确的空格。
2. 如何在Excel中设置单元格自动乘以0.8的功能?
您可以使用Excel的乘法公式来实现这个功能。在要进行乘法计算的单元格中,输入等于号(=),然后输入要乘以的数值(0.8),最后按下回车键即可。
3. 我如何在整个Excel工作表中自动将所有单元格乘以0.8?
要在整个Excel工作表中自动将所有单元格乘以0.8,可以使用以下步骤:
- 选中要进行乘法计算的单元格范围。
- 在公式栏中输入乘法公式,例如*=A10.8,其中A1是要乘以0.8的单元格。
- 按下Ctrl+Enter键,同时在选定的范围内应用公式。
这样,所有选定的单元格将自动乘以0.8并显示结果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4912043